Our client is seeking a Mechanical Designer with automation experience to join their team. As a Mechanical Designer, you will be responsible for developing innovative solutions for Powertrain Machining, Assembly, and Test production systems. The ideal candidate will have ability to work independently & as part of cross-functional teams, able to work under minimal supervision and exhibit a high attention to detail which will align successfully in the organization.

Job Title: Mechanical Designer
Location: Southfield, MI
Pay Rate: Pay is between $30-40/hour w2 (Will be dependent on experience level)

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op the concepts, designs, details, stocklists and layouts to meet project requirements using Solidworks Cad Software
  • Develop complete designs for Manual, Automatic, and Semi-Automatic Stations and Machines. Assist the Manufacturing and Commissioning teams in the implementation of the technical solutions
Requirements
  • 5+ years Mechanical Design and Engineering experience in Powertrain or Associates Degree in Mechanical Technology or equivalent experience
  • Ability to work independently and within teams
